Subject: Catalog cache invalidation change — plugin impact

Hello plugin authors,

Starting with the next Orvendale release, catalog cache entries invalidate per-SKU rather than per-category. Plugins that assumed category-wide flushes should subscribe to the new item-level event instead; the old hook remains but fires less often. Please test against the candidate build identified by the token below.

pipeline stamp: htk4_ae36

Night shift: staff from Berrow Analytics may use our canteen between 22:00 and 04:00 under the shared-facilities agreement. They must sign the visitor ledger at the north entrance and stay within the canteen area. Do not escort them past the galley corridor. Report any unbadged visitor to the duty supervisor immediately. To admit Berrow staff through the canteen side door, use the pass code below.

door code, kawip-bagap: bdg-HQEWH-4

Off-site run checklist — Item 7: Payslips, Torvane Quarry site

Torvane has no printer, so the sealed payslip envelopes travel with the weekly courier pouch. Records team: print, seal, and log each envelope against the staff roster before dispatch, and retain the manifest copy for audit. Envelopes must not be folded or combined. The confidential courier hand-over instruction follows.

handover note for yagef-bagep: the drudor pelius courier leaves the kasdor zorvan norir ledger at gate 8016 under passcode 755406

## Step 4: Enable fan-out backpressure

Before promoting Larkspur Notify v9, switch the fan-out workers to the bounded queue mode. Without it, a burst from the Coppervale digest job can starve downstream consumers and delay pages. The change is config-only; no restart ordering matters. Apply the following values to each worker group.

deployment values, kadup-fafop:
[fenael]
port = 8000
region = lower-3
host = fenael.sivrelcloud.internal
team = wenwyn
timeout_ms = 2000
retries = 8